Professional Documents
Culture Documents
ON
LIBRARY
MANAGEMENT SYSTEM
BY
NAME (0681118…..)
NAME (0681118…..)
I hereby declare that the work presented in the case study titled LIBRARY
Mrs. Name of Guide, Assistant Professor of Computer Science. The same work has not
CAROLIN THOMAS
SIMLA L S
SCHOOL OF DISTANCE EDUCATION
UNIVERSITY OF KERALA
KARIYAVATTOM
CERTIFICATE
fulfillment of the requirement for the award of the Degree of MASTER OF COMPUTER
External Examiner1
Lecturer in charge
External Examiner2
ACKNOWLEDGEMENT
Before we get into the things, we would like to add a few heartfelt words for the several
prominent personalities, who were part of this project in numerous ways, people who gave
unending support and valuable assistance right from the project idea was conceived.
First and foremost we acknowledge the abiding presence and abounding grace of Lord
Almighty for his shower of blessing which has enabled us to attain success in this endeavor.
We are indebted to our parents for their moral support and their consistent encouragement with
We express our deep sense of gratitude to our honorable Director Dr. K. S. Suresh Kumar,
School of Distance Education, University of Kerala for the kind inspiration and providing the
I would like to acknowledge and give my warmest thanks to Mrs. Liji I H, Coordinator and
Assistant Professor of Computer Science, University of Kerala who made this work possible.
Her advice carried me through all the stages of doing this project.
It is indeed a great pleasure and privilege to express a sense of gratitude to Mrs. Arya S V,
Guide and Assistant Professor of Computer Science, University of Kerala for the valuable
suggestions and support, which helped us a lot in the successful completion of this project.
Finally with sense of gratitude we wish to acknowledge the untiring efforts of all the staff
members of our department for their immense support and encouragement. We would be
CAROLIN THOMAS
SIMLA L S
ABSTRACT
A Library Management System is a system that is used to maintain the records of the library.
It contains work like the number of available books, the number of books issued, the number
of books to return or renew. It helps to maintain a database that is useful to enter new books
and records of books borrowed by the members with the respective submission dates. It will
reduce the manual work done by the librarian to maintain the records of the library. It allows
maintaining the resources in a more operative manner that will help to save time. It is also
convenient for the librarian to manage the process of books allocation. It is useful for
students as well as a librarian to keep constant track of the availability of all books in a
library.
TABLE OF CONTENTS
1. INTRODUCTION 1
2. SYSTEM ANALYSIS 2
2.1 EXISTING SYSTEM 3
2.2 PROPOSED SYSTEM 5
3. SYSTEM SPECIFICATION 7
3.1 HARDWARE SPECIFICATION 7
3.2 SOFTWARE SPECIFICATION 7
3.3 DEVELOPING TOOLS 8
4. SYSTEM DESIGN 13
4.1 INPUT DESIGN 13
4.2 OUTPUT DESIGN 14
4.3 DATABASE DESIGN 15
4.4 DATA FLOW DIAGRAM 17
5.SYSTEM IMPLEMENTATION 23
5.1IMPLEMENTATION 23
5.2 TRAINING 25
6. SYSTEM TESTING 27
6.1 TESTING OBJECTIVES 27
6.2 TYPES OF TESTING 28
7.SYSYTEM MAINTENANCE 30
8. CONCLUSION 31
9. FUTURE ENHANCEMENT 32
10. BIBLIOGRAPHY 33
APPENDIX 34
A. Screenshots
B. Source code